STURGEON BAY, WI (WTAQ-WLUK) – Mass COVID-19 vaccination clinics at Door County Medical Center will no longer be held after this month.
The hospital says it is discontinuing the clinics at the end of the month. The decision is based on a fast start to community vaccinations and decreasing demand for continued vaccinations.
As of Wednesday, Door County Medical Center has administered nearly 10,000 vaccine doses, with about 3,300 people fully vaccinated. Door County leads the state with over 50% of residents having received at least one dose, according to a news release.
The hospital is providing the two-dose Moderna vaccine for anyone at least 18 years old.
